America’s failure to ensure paid sick leave for its employees may mix with the coronavirus to pose a critical hazard to public well being within the coming weeks.
The Covid-19 sickness, attributable to the coronavirus, is right here and sure right here to remain for some time. The Facilities for Illness Management and Prevention are warning folks to be ready for main disruptions of their day by day lives. That might imply staying dwelling for days in the event that they get sick.
However that’s simpler mentioned than finished for hundreds of thousands of American employees. Staff within the service trade particularly, like meals employees or private care assistants, are a lot much less seemingly than their friends in additional profitable fields to have paid day without work in the event that they get sick. However additionally they make much less cash typically, that means a misplaced day of labor hurts their households’ budgets extra. That provides them a powerful motivation to enter work — even when they’re not feeling properly.
And since these employees are available shut contact with the remainder of humanity, they’re a potent vector for spreading contagions, notably these as infectious as coronaviruses. It’s a recipe for making a foul outbreak even worse, all as a result of America hasn’t determined to ensure paid sick go away for all employees.
Why having no paid sick go away is a public well being threat
There is no such thing as a federal legislation guaranteeing paid day without work for sickness, and paid sick go away is relatively uncommon for lower-wage employees. Simply 63 p.c of individuals working in service occupations have paid sick go away, versus greater than 90 p.c of individuals in administration positions, in accordance with the Bureau of Labor Statistics. For folks working part-time, simply 43 p.c can get sick go away from their employer.
And for folks working these lower-wage jobs, it’s not simple for them to skip work in the event that they’re not getting paid, even when they’re feeling flu-like signs that might be both the flu itself or the coronavirus.
All the general public well being warnings on the planet can’t all the time rise up in opposition to the necessity to deliver dwelling a paycheck. Simply 27 p.c of individuals whose wages fall within the backside 10 p.c are capable of earn paid sick go away from their job, in accordance with the Economic Policy Institute. Any much less pay eats into their fundamental wants: As EPI put it, the misplaced wages from lacking three days of labor can equal a month’s value of groceries or their month-to-month utility payments.
Folks have a powerful incentive to go to work, even when they’re not feeling properly and authorities have urged them to remain dwelling. And as soon as they arrive in and begin going about their jobs, they’ll unfold sicknesses unintentionally. Coronavirus is a reasonably contagious illness, with the next R-naught (which measures what number of different folks a sick particular person is more likely to infect) than the seasonal flu.
Paid sick go away may go a protracted technique to cease the unfold of the virus. As a gaggle of researchers wrote for the CDC in 2012, whereas assessing the advantages of offering employees with paid day without work in the event that they get sick (emphasis mine):
Entry to paid sick go away would possibly scale back the stress to work whereas sick out of worry of dropping revenue. Fewer folks working whereas sick, and subsequently acting at diminished purposeful capability, would possibly result in safer operations and fewer accidents. The potential security profit noticed in our research extends earlier analysis demonstrating that paid sick go away is related to shorter employee restoration instances and diminished problems from minor well being issues. Paid sick go away additionally permits employees to look after family members and may help forestall the unfold of contagious illnesses.
America is alone amongst superior economies in not having a nationwide assure of paid sick go away for employees. Because the Heart for Financial and Coverage Analysis reported in 2009, most developed economies give employees not less than 5 days off to get better from flu-like methods. The US used to lag even farther behind, with lower than half of service trade employees getting paid sick go away as not too long ago as 2017. However because of a slew of latest state legal guidelines mandating such go away, the state of affairs has improved.
Paid sick go away is normally handled as a precept of fundamental financial justice: Folks shouldn’t turn into financially insecure as a result of they get sick and should miss work. However when we have now an outbreak like coronavirus, the failure to offer that safety is actively making our society extra susceptible to a giant outbreak.
